The Critical Role of Licensing in Online Casinos

Regulatory licensing acts as the industry’s gold standard, establishing foundational trust. Licensing authorities—such as those in the United Kingdom, Malta, Gibraltar, and more recently, jurisdictions like Curaçao—set strict criteria governing operational practices, financial stability, and fair gaming policies. These authorities rigorously scrutinise online casino operators before granting licensure, requiring comprehensive audits of software integrity, anti-money laundering (AML) measures, and responsible gaming protocols.

One illustrative example of rigorous licensing standards is the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which enforces mandatory compliance with the Gambling Act 2005. It mandates regular audits, player fund segregation, and transparency in marketing. Notably, the UKGC’s emphasis on player protection has elevated UK-licensed operators as reputable entities globally.

Industry Insights: Evolving Regulatory Landscape

As the industry matures, new trends and regulatory adjustments are shaping how online casinos operate and are perceived. Some noteworthy developments include:

  • Enhanced Player Verification: To combat fraud and underage gambling, authorities are requiring multi-factor authentication and real-time identity checks.
  • Cryptocurrency Regulation: While crypto offers increased anonymity and faster transactions, regulators are developing frameworks to mitigate risks associated with money laundering and unlicensed operators.
  • Gamification & Fairness Transparency: The adoption of advanced RNG (Random Number Generator) audits and provably fair algorithms demonstrates a move towards technological transparency and player agency.

The Evolution and Role of Scatter Symbols in Slot Gaming

Originally introduced to diversify the appeal of physical slot machines, scatter symbols have since become a cornerstone of digital slot design. Unlike standard symbols, which typically activate paylines, scatter symbols function independently of payline structures, unlocking bonus features, free spins, or multipliers when a sufficient number appear across the reels.
